I did some more reading and hit a couple parks that were around since the 1880's - and as I was hunting I noticed many pie-shaped holes dug into the ground by another person that had hunted the same area. (Fixed them as much as I could - didn't want anyone making a fuss over it. Still, makes me mad to see someone who leaves such a mess!) The funny thing is that I found most of my finds near or right on top of the spots that had already been dug! The two liberty 50 cent coins were in the same hole as the one of the ones I fixed! Must have not been very patient I guess.

Scared up a few rings but they weren't gold/silver but still fun to see pop out. I'm hoping the weather will last this afternoon so I can get out again this lovely 4th of July!
